A bill to be entitled 1 
An act relating to two -way radio communication 2 
enhancement systems; amending s. 633.202, F.S.; 3 
authorizing the use of two -way radio communication 4 
enhancement systems to comply with certain radio 5 
signal strength requirements in the Florida Fire 6 
Prevention Code; exempting certain apartment buildings 7 
from requiring two-way radio communication enhancement 8 
systems; providing an effective date. 9 
 10 
Be It Enacted by the Legislature of the State of Florida: 11 
 12 
 Section 1.  Subsection (18) of section 633.202, Florida 13 
Statutes, is amended to read: 14 
 633.202  Florida Fire Prevention Code. — 15 
 (18)  The authority having jurisdiction shall determine the 16 
minimum radio signal st rength for fire department communications 17 
in all new high-rise and existing high -rise buildings. Two-way 18 
radio communication enhancement systems or equivalent systems 19 
may be used to comply with the minimum radio signal strength 20 
requirements. However, two -way radio communication enhancement 21 
systems or equivalent systems are not required in apartment 22 
buildings 75 feet or less in height with the exterior components 23 
constructed of wood frame. Evidence of wood frame construction 24 
shall be shown by the property ow ner providing building permit 25

documentation which identifies the construction type as wood 26 
frame. Existing buildings are not required to comply with 27 
minimum radio strength for fire department communications and 28 
two-way radio communication enhancement syste ms system 29 
enhancement communications as required by the Florida Fire 30 
Prevention Code until January 1, 2025. However, by January 1, 31 
2024, an existing building that is not in compliance with the 32 
requirements for minimum radio strength for fire department 33 
communications must apply for an appropriate permit for the 34 
required installation with the local government agency having 35 
jurisdiction and must demonstrate that the building will become 36 
compliant by January 1, 2025. Existing apartment buildings are 37 
not required to comply until January 1, 2025. However, existing 38 
apartment buildings are required to apply for the appropriate 39 
permit for the required communications installation by January 40 
1, 2024. 41 
 Section 2.  This act shall take effect July 1, 2022. 42
